A remote design intern is an entry-level position where the successful candidate works underneath a graphic designer. The remote design intern assists the graphic designer to create clear, compelling graphics for both print and digital content. This comes in the form of marketing brochures, direct mail pieces, website and social media graphics, posters, flyers, and other marketing items. Remote design interns are also expected to update the company website with text, images, videos, company logo, etc. The intern receives instructions and collaborates with the marketing and design teams to support their respective functions.

The challenges of working as a remote design intern include the lack of a stable learning environment and social interaction. Design interns (and interns in general) are there to learn as much as they can while also being an asset to a company. They are usually young and energetic individuals who are eager to network and feel like part of the company. Working remotely as an intern lacks this aspect.
